Bonuses, Wagering Rules, and the Small Print
Promotional offers can look attractive until the wagering conditions arrive wearing a sensible grey suit. A bonus may include a deposit requirement, a playthrough multiplier, a maximum qualifying stake, restricted games, and an expiry period. Each condition can materially change the value of the offer, so the headline figure should never be treated as the complete offer.
Players should pay particular attention to whether bonus funds and winnings are separated, how contributions vary by game, and whether a maximum cash-out applies. A promotion that suits a low-stakes slot player may be unhelpful to someone who prefers live roulette. There is no universal “good bonus”; there is only a set of rules that may or may not fit a particular playing style.
Banking, Withdrawals, and Account Checks
Payment options are part of the practical experience rather than a footnote. Card payments, bank transfers, and electronic wallets may differ in processing time, minimum amounts, fees, and verification requirements. Players should confirm the currency supported by the account and check whether a method used for deposits is also available for withdrawals.
Identity checks can feel inconvenient, but they are a standard part of regulated gambling. Documents may be requested before a withdrawal is completed, particularly when account details, payment ownership, or source-of-funds information needs confirmation. Providing clear documents and using matching personal details usually creates fewer delays than treating verification like an optional side quest.

Responsible Play and Final Assessment
A credible casino experience should make control tools visible rather than hiding them beneath several layers of cheerful branding. Deposit limits, session reminders, time-outs, self-exclusion, and reality checks can help players keep gambling within a defined entertainment budget. The useful figure is the amount a person can comfortably lose, not the amount they hope a lucky streak will produce.
